#1160ce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1160ce is composed of 6.7% red, 37.6% green and 80.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 91.7% cyan, 53.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 19.2% black. It has a hue angle of 214.9 degrees, a saturation of 84.8% and a lightness of 43.7%. #1160ce color hex could be obtained by blending #22c0ff with #00009d. Closest websafe color is: #0066cc.

#1160ce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1160ce has RGB values of R:17, G:96, B:206 and CMYK values of C:0.92, M:0.53, Y:0, K:0.19. Its decimal value is 1138894.
| Hex triplet | 1160ce | #1160ce |
|---|---|---|
| RGB Decimal | 17, 96, 206 | rgb(17,96,206) |
| RGB Percent | 6.7, 37.6, 80.8 | rgb(6.7%,37.6%,80.8%) |
| CMYK | 92, 53, 0, 19 | |
| HSL | 214.9°, 84.8, 43.7 | hsl(214.9,84.8%,43.7%) |
| HSV (or HSB) | 214.9°, 91.7, 80.8 | |
| Web Safe | 0066cc | #0066cc |
| CIE-LAB | 42.672, 20.579, -62.87 |
|---|---|
| XYZ | 15.552, 12.94, 60.067 |
| xyY | 0.176, 0.146, 12.94 |
| CIE-LCH | 42.672, 66.153, 288.124 |
| CIE-LUV | 42.672, -21.23, -94.09 |
| Hunter-Lab | 35.972, 14.222, -73.824 |
| Binary | 00010001, 01100000, 11001110 |
